Alex Trebek wouldn't give up his Toronto Maple Leafs jersey. Not even for the "Jeopardy!" Hall of Fame.

The legendary game show aired one of the late host's favorite episodes, which included a hockey category where he produced two video clues with former Maple Leafs forward Tie Domi.
Trebek was an avid hockey fan from Sudbury, Ontario, who helped
the Ottawa Senators announce
their selection of Tim Stuetzle at the 2020 NHL Draft. He died of
pancreatic cancer at age 80
on Nov. 8, and "Jeopardy!" is airing Trebek's favorite episodes for two weeks around the holidays.
On Monday the game show aired an episode from Oct. 14, 2004 where Trebek got to hit the ice at the Leafs' home arena in his own personalized No. ? jersey. The show's Twitter page shared some trivia about Trebek's fondness for that episode and the jersey, which he refused to part with.

Be sure to note a young Ken Jennings answering the most questions of the three contestants correctly.
Trebek may have felt most fond about his jersey and time on the ice with Domi, but he also enjoyed the thrill that was a photoshoot with Toronto mascot Carlton the Bear.
